US embassy in Jerusalem to open in 2019: Pence

Proud to be in ‘Israel’s capital, Jerusalem’: US vice president

OCCUPIED JERUSALEM — The US embassy in Israel will move to Jerusalem by the end of 2019, US Vice President Mike Pence said on Monday.

“In the weeks ahead, our administration will advance its plan to open the US Embassy in Jerusalem — and that United States Embassy will open before the end of next year,” Pence said in a speech to the Israeli parliament in occupied Jerusalem.

“Jerusalem is Israel’s capital — and, as such, President Trump has directed the State Department to begin initial preparations to move our embassy from Tel Aviv to Jerusalem,” said Pence.

Israeli Arab lawmakers were ejected from parliament as they stood to protest the speech from the rostrum by Pence.

Members of the Joint List coalition of Arab parties had pledged to boycott the Pence speech in protest at the Dec. 6 decision by US President Donald Trump to recognize Jerusalem as Israel’s capital.

A number of parliamentarians began shouting and holding up protest signs at the beginning of Pence’s speech, before ushers pushed them out.

Pence kicked off his visit to Israel with a Monday morning meeting with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u in which he said it was an honor to be in “Israel’s capital, Jerusalem.”

Netanyahu told Pence it was the first time a visiting dignitary could utter those three words along with him, and he thanked Pence for President Donald Trump’s “historic” recognition of Jerusalem. — Agencies
